## Ownership

The BranchReaper bot scans the Corvid Systems monorepo nightly and flags branches with no commits in 90 days. It opens a deletion proposal rather than deleting outright, so nothing is lost without review. As a contractor, you should never approve these proposals yourself; they require sign-off from the maintainer of record. If the bot misbehaves — false flags, stuck proposals, or missed scans — escalate immediately. All escalations and approvals go through the current owner, whose name follows below.

named custodian: Brivan Eliath Quenox Frador

## Provenance: Quillbranch N+1 Fix

The batched-loader change that resolved the Quillbranch GraphQL N+1 issue (author lookups fanning out per comment) shipped through the standard attested pipeline. Dataloader caching is scoped per-request, and the provenance attestation covers both the resolver patch and the regenerated schema artifacts. For the weekly sync, confirm deployment lineage by matching the attestation digest to the token recorded below.

session token of tajef-bageg = htk21_5d90d574934f3ccae6437

### RestockPilot: Release Prerequisites

Before cutting a release, confirm that the RestockPilot planner can reach the SnackGrid inventory service, since the build pipeline runs an integration smoke test against staging during packaging. A failed handshake here blocks the release tag, so verify credentials first. The pipeline reads its staging credential from the deploy config; for reference and manual verification, the current key appears below.

service key, tajof-fawip: vxb4-JNOz

Subject: Retention sweeper v4 shipped

Team — the Dunmire retention sweeper is live on all shards. It now honors per-tenant hold flags and skips anything under legal review. Future maintainers: the sweep interval is in the Larkspool config, not hardcoded; don't reintroduce the old cron. Dry-run mode logs deletions without executing — use it before any policy change. Rollback is a config flip, no redeploy needed. The deployed build is identified by the token below.

pipeline stamp: htk21_0e1a1ddcdb5bfd88d6dd6